His weaknesses were always going to be exposed but he was 20-0 and on a decent five fight run: KO'd Szpilka as the underdog (went on to beat Wach and drop Rozanski), KO'd Kiladze (went on to drop Ajagba and Faust x2), beat Martin (went on to KO Washington and drop Ortiz x2), KO'd Washington (went on to KO Helenius) and beat Arreola (went on to go 12 rounds with and drop Ruiz) in a punch stat breaking fight.
